White's journey began humbly enough, growing up in Southern California where he quickly distinguished himself on both snowboards and skateboards. By age six, he earned the nickname Flying Tomato due to his fiery red hair and prodigious talent. Over time, his reputation solidified with victories across multiple disciplines, culminating in three Olympic gold medals and numerous X Games titles. Yet, these accolades were accompanied by scrutiny regarding whether his commercial endeavors align with core values cherished by purists.

One notable moment capturing public imagination occurred during the 2018 PyeongChang Winter Olympics. Competing against younger rivals like Japan's Ayumu Hirano, White executed a breathtaking final run scoring 97.75 points—a performance many deemed impossible given prior missteps earlier in the event. This triumph underscored resilience amidst pressure while reinforcing his status as one of history's greatest snowboarders.
